Ever notice this icon > in the corner of the ads you see as you browse the web? The AdChoices symbol appears on web pages and ads to let you know when information about your interests or demographics may have been collected or used to show you ads – what’s known as interest-based advertising.
You may come across such ads when you’re viewing a website, video, or app on Google’s Display Network. In addition to seeing ads based on your interests, you may also see ads based on the types of sites you visit, whether you +1 something, and more.
What Google does and doesn’t do to show you ads
We may show you ads based on many factors, including
The DoubleClick cookie on your browser
The contents of the website you’re viewing, if it’s part of the Display Network
The types of websites you visit, if they’re part of the Display Network
Whether you’ve previously interacted with any of Google’s ads or ad-type features
Anything you +1 on Google and across the web
We don’t do the following:
Link your name or personally identifiable information to your DoubleClick cookie without your consent
Associate your DoubleClick cookie with sensitive topics like race, religion, sexual orientation, or health without your consent
How you can manage your ad preferences
You can manage your ad preferences with web-based tools and controls. Below are just a few tools of the tools, controls, and resources developed by Google and other organizations to help you do so:
Tools, controls, and resources What it is
Ads Preferences Manager. A Google tool that lets you opt out of Google’s interest-based ads or edit the interests and demographics associated with your browser.
Aboutads.info
Online Choices (for European users) Cross-industry controls that let you opt out of interest-based ads.
Privacy tools Google’s browser controls, plug-ins, and product features designed to help you protect your privacy. Choose from over a dozen.
+1 personalization Your Google accounts page where you choose whether Google may use your +1's and other profile information to personalize your content and ads on non-Google websites.
